Airport
Mexico City's main airport (MEX) has two terminals. Terminal 1 serves most airlines, while Terminal 2 is primarily for Aeroméxico and SkyTeam flights. They are in separate locations, so it is worth checking in advance which terminal you'll be arriving at.
Transportation
For local transfers, Uber is safe, convenient, and affordable, and is the most common rideshare app in Mexico City. Private transportation can also be arranged through your hotel.
